The products will appear in stores one to two weeks before the PSP's March 24 launch, according to Mark Stanley, Intec's senior vice president of marketing. The pro gamer's kit ($29.99) includes the screen lens protector, DC adaptor, game case, docking station, earphones, and a PSP neck strap. The starter kit ($14.99) comes with earphones, the screen lens protector, and the DC power adaptor. The company is also offering two accessory kits. Intec's PSP lineup includes a docking station ($9.99), earphones ($9.99), large and small aluminum carrying cases ($19.99 and $9.99, respectively), a leather case ($14.99), an AC adaptor ($14.99), a DC car power adaptor ($9.99), a case that holds two PSP games ($4.99), and a screen lens protector ($4.99). Accessory maker Intec began shipping its line of PSP add-ons today, becoming the first third-party manufacturer to do so.
